Former social media aide to ex-president Goodluck Jonathan and founder of Mind of Christ Christian Center, Reno Omokri has attacked the #OccupyNigeria protests which erupted in January 2012 following the announcement of the removal of subsidy by the Federal Government on the first day of the year.
Reno’s attack is a reaction to the recent removal of subsidy of fuel by the Muhammadu Buhari led administration on Wednesday, May 11.
On his Twitter page, the former presidential aide lambasted the All Progressives Congress and all the other front runners of the #OccupyNaija accusing them of using the protest for their selfish gains instead of in the interest of Nigerians.
